Ideas for unscheduled or drop-in activities?

Hi ladies,

New SAHM mom here.  My DS is now 4.5 months old.  I'm looking to start getting out of the house a little more, for my own sanity and to expose DS to new things.  We're still figuring out our routine and naps - things change every week it seems.  I'm trying to find some activities to do or places to go that will be more flexible with DS's changing schedule.  It's hard to commit to things (mom groups, mom and baby fitness classes, etc.) when he sleeps so much right now.  I usually only have a 1.5 - 2 hour window when he's awake. What kinds of things did you do with your little one at this age to get out of the house and meet people?

I'm thinking drop-in or unstructured type activities would be best.  Any ideas, tips, or advice would be greatly appreciated.  Thank you!

    Really, at that point, we didn't do much.  I was actually still working then but unless we went somewhere to walk around or something, there wasn't much else to do.  Young like that is hard because they aren't walking so any sort of play area is out, the couldn't care less about a story time type thing.

    My suggestion would be to get out and go on walks or walk around the mall or something.  You may not meet many people that way (that will come later) but it will at least get you out.

    at 4.5 months, just getting out to do your activities is enough stimulation for your baby. Walks, errands, lunch with friends, whatever. I would go the playdates when he's awake and it works, but otherwise I'd enjoy this time when he is still so mobile and able to sleep on the go.

    I just got a calendar for the MOMs group in my area.  Do you have one of those?  You don't have to commit to anything.  They just put the calendar out monthly and they do things like meet for a stroller walk on certain days, coffee, etc.  You rsvp so they know to wait for you but none of the activities are required and the times and days are different every month.
